Ireland's electricity among most expensive in EU

Ireland's electricity prices were the third highest in the EU in the second half of 2014.

According to figures released by Eurostat, the most expensive rates were in Denmark and Germany.

There was a 5.4% increase in household electricity prices in Ireland between the second half of 2013 and the second half of last year.

The lowest rates were in Romania and Hungary.
